Northfield Farm is a free range farm in Melton Mowbray, Leicestershire. They specialise in rearing their own rare and traditional British breeds. They were accredited as a butcher by the Rare Breeds Survival Trust in 1997 and also produce award-winning burgers and sausages.
Northfield Farm quality standards
While they rear and butcher a majority of their meat, they have now formed an informal cooperative with other farms with similar principles. They now encourage others to breed, rear and finish rare and traditional breeds.
According to their website:
“Here at Northfield Farm we have chosen traditional breeds that are reared slowly and naturally outdoors, except during the worst of winter when they live in our barns and are fed from hay and silage which we have made from our own grassland.
Slowly reared animals taste better because their flavour has had time to develop at its natural rate.”

Sustainability projects
The farm is dedicated exclusively to raising rare and traditional British breeds. This ensures that the animals live in their natural habitat and this contributes to a cycle of sustainability.
